Video encoding
- Video codecs: HEVC, H.264, MPEG-2, JPEG-XS
- Chroma & bit depth: 4:2:2 10-bit / 8-bit. 4:2:0 8-bit (10-bit UHD).
- Resolutions: 480i (SD), up to 2160p (UHD)
- Framerates: 23.98, 24, 25, 29.97, 50, 59.94
UHD | HD | SD |
---|---|---|
4:2:2 10 bit or 4:2:0 8 bit HEVC encoding | 4:2:2 10 bit or 4:2:0 8 bit MPEG-4 AVC or HEVC encoding | 4:2:0 8-bit MPEG-2, MPEG-4 AVC or HEVC |
4:2:2 or 4:2:0 8 bit MPEG-2 encoding | 4:2:2 8-bit MPEG-2 | |
2160p 23.98, 24, 25, 29.97, 50 or 59.94 frame rates | 1080i25/29.97, 720p50/59.94, 1080p50/59.94 frame rate | 480i 29.97, 576i 25 |
Audio encoding
- Audio codecs: MPEG-1 Layer-II, AAC, HE-AAC, HE-AAC v2 1. Dolby Digital® 2.0 / 5.1, Dolby Digital Plus® 2.0, 5.1, Dolby AC-3
- Audio channels: Up to 8 stereo pairs per service
- Passthrough: Dolby E®, Dolby Digital®, Dolby Digital Plus®, Linear PCM (as SMPTE 302)
- Data rate: From 4.75 kbps to 320 kbps (from 64 to 1024 kbps for DD+)

Modulation
- Type: DVB-S, DVB-DSNG, DVB-S2, DVB-S2X
- Constellation: QPSK, 8PSK, 16APSK to 32APSK 2
- Roll-off: DVB-S/DSNG: 35% DVB-S2: 20, 25 or 35%
- DVB-S2X: 5, 10, 15, 20, 25, 35%
- Symbol rate: 0.05 to 36 MSym/s 2
RF output
- L-Band frequency range: 950 MHz to 2150 MHz (1 KHz step)
- L-Band output power: -35 dBm up to +5 dBm (0.1 dB step)
- IF frequency range: 50 MHz to 180 MHz (1 Hz step)
- IF output power: -35 dBm up to +5 dBm (0.1 dB steps)
- IF monitor output power: -20dB on the RF output
